Understanding the Importance of Medical Device Testing
In today’s fast-paced healthcare landscape, the integrity and performance of medical devices are paramount. With increasing innovation comes an equally pressing need to ensure these devices undergo rigorous testing. Medical device testing isn’t merely a regulatory formality; it’s a crucial procedure that helps to safeguard patient safety. The complexity of devices may involve intricate hardware and sophisticated software components, all of which demand a comprehensive assessment to verify they function accurately and reliably in a clinical setting.
Medical device testing encompasses several key areas, including performance optimization, reliability under stress, and compliance with stringent industry standards. The role of tailored test systems cannot be understated. These systems are designed specifically to evaluate the unique functionalities of medical devices in environments that replicate real-world conditions. This targeted testing ensures that the devices perform according to the intended specifications, thereby augmenting the reliability and effectiveness that healthcare practitioners expect from the technology they rely on.
As technological advancements lead to more complex devices, the methodologies for testing them likewise evolve. Companies must stay abreast of new protocols that integrate the latest innovations in design and functionality. Strategies such as accelerated life testing, stress testing, and environmental testing play an essential part in certifying that medical devices can withstand the rigors of real-world application. The overarching goal of medical device testing is not only to secure regulatory compliance but also to instill confidence in both manufacturers and healthcare professionals regarding the safety and efficacy of their devices.
